Polar Plunge Rules and Tips:

Plungers must submerge their entire body (yes, including their head, into the water). You can tread out as deep as necessary and lay down or just run out and go under. Your choice. No wetsuits or other protective clothing are allowed, though footwear is recommended. Costumes are a fun way to celebrate and encouraged. We'll have divers out there keeping an eye on things- Give em' a high 5 and head back in! We will also have na inflatable waterslide, set up on the beach, providing multiple options for you brave plungers!!
 
Below are some tips from folks who have plunged in MUCH colder waters:
-Do Not enter this event if you have high blood pressure and/or heart conditions that will put you at risk when you are immersed in cold water.  If you have a heart problem...please just come and watch.
-Do Not drink alcohol prior to this event.   Alcohol does not warm you up and it accelerates hypothermia.
-Do Not stay in the water longer than 15 minutes.  Body heat is lost 25 times faster in water than in air.
-Do Not remove your clothing until swim time.
-Do bring a warm change of clothes, socks, shoes, hat, and blanket for post-plunge warm up
-Have fun and enjoy the craziness of the moment!!

The QuadBurner Event Series

The QuadBurner Event Series consists of five, short course, themed races that are spread out over a full calendar year. These events all take place along the beautiful coastal waters of Bay St. Louis Beach, Mississippi.
This series has a little bit of something for everyone. From kids to adults, elites to newcomers, and families looking for a way to be active together.
Race one event or race them all, the choice is yours. Each one is unique, yet they all share a common objective-

Every participant, of every event, receives:  professional chip-timed race, finishers medal, top notch swag, and entry to a killer after-party! We began the series 7 years ago as a way to encourage year round fitness. While this continues to be one of our primary goals, we also work tirelessly to raise funds for The Hancock County Canine Operation. These events help us all stay fit, add to our outstanding medal and t-shirt collections all while supporting our local law enforcement operations.
